    Campaign Members allow you to associate contacts and leads to various campaigns in Salesforce. Campaigns are often used by Marketing Teams to track various marketing engagements, such as if your company is going to a trade show, and you want to track everyone who signed up at that trade show, or if your company is planning an email engagement, and you want to track all the recipients. Campaigns are a great way to track and manage each customer you're reaching out to as part of that campaign. 

     

    One of the unique features of Campaigns is that you can assign both leads and contacts as Campaign Members. The Campaign Member object is a junction object, meaning that is has a parent Campaign, but then it has a Parent Lead or Contact. This allows great flexibility so that you can assign multiple leads and comtacts to multiple campaigns.
